当前位置:   article > 正文

VS:预处理器定义_vs预处理器定义

vs预处理器定义

问题:

上图中的预处理器定义作用是什么?

答:在图中,

WIN32_DEBUGE_UNICODE等其实是一些宏定义,

在这里写上这些,相当于在本工程所有的文件中都写上了

  1. #define WIN32
  2. #define _DEBUG
  3. #define _UNICODE

这样,在不同的配置环境在编译的结果文件不一样,从而实现跨平台

比如,在VC中,因为要有的环境是UNICODE,有些则不是,同一份代码为了在两种环境下都可以用;

参考文章:

1. https://www.cnblogs.com/Crysaty/p/6605419.html

 

 

 

声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/煮酒与君饮/article/detail/756426?site
推荐阅读
相关标签
  

闽ICP备14008679号